match ip address — route-map

Synopsis

match ip address access-list
no match ip address access-list

Configures

Route filtering

Default

None

Description

This command is used to match the IP address of the route’s destination. If the destination matches the specified access list, the route is included in the map and processed according to the other statements in the route map. With this command, you can use extended access lists to implement routing policies.
